The Truth Behind the Name: Pencil ≠ Lead
The term “lead pencil” is a historical misnomer that dates back centuries. While today’s pencils are safe from actual lead, they may still carry other risks. Many pencils on the market today are coated with synthetic paints or treated with chemicals that can be harmful, especially to children or those who frequently use pencils for long periods.

Why Basswood? The Secret Behind a Superior Writing Experience
At the heart of our pencil is the carefully selected basswood — a material known for its softness, durability, and natural beauty. Basswood is a premium choice for high-quality pencils due to its fine grain and smooth texture. It’s easy to shape, resistant to splintering, and offers a comfortable grip even during extended writing sessions.
Beyond comfort, basswood is also a sustainable choice. Sourced from responsibly managed forests, it supports eco-friendly production practices and helps reduce environmental impact. Choosing the Right Pencil: A Guide
Not all pencils are created equal. When selecting a pencil for yourself or someone else, consider the following factors:
- Certifications: Look for pencils that meet international safety and environmental standards such as ISO, EN71, or CPSIA.
- Feel: A well-made pencil should feel smooth to the touch and comfortable to hold.
- Performance: Test the pencil for smoothness, clarity of line, and resistance to breakage.
- Smell: A natural wood scent indicates quality craftsmanship and minimal chemical use.
